Output 8c3d9d05807834ccca8f5cfaad48f66c93452ec84d88130da9dc1483aeab7eb9:3

value
44443955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d24aa6a514ba0f0c1100fe6e488487d99d5fecff OP_EQUAL
address
3LrwFffp5rQYSsgLYyn7NE5bP7R8v2P4gL
transaction
8c3d9d05807834ccca8f5cfaad48f66c93452ec84d88130da9dc1483aeab7eb9
spent
true